At its core, artificial intelligence refers to the simulation of human intelligence in machines that are programmed to think and learn like humans.
This encompasses various facets, including problem-solving, speech recognition, and decision-making. Machine learning, a subset of AI, plays a pivotal role in this landscape. It enables computers to learn from data and improve their performance over time without being explicitly programmed.One of the most significant applications of AI can be observed in the realm of healthcare. The ability of AI to analyze vast amounts of data quickly and accurately has led to groundbreaking advancements in diagnostics and personalized medicine.
For instance, AI algorithms can analyze medical images, such as X-rays and MRIs, with a level of precision that rival human experts. This not only expedites the diagnostic process but also enhances its accuracy, ultimately leading to better patient outcomes.Moreover, AI-powered tools can assist healthcare professionals in identifying patterns and trends that may not be immediately apparent. By leveraging historical data, AI can help predict potential health risks for patients, enabling preventative measures to be taken.
